    Mr Eazi Set To Release Mixtape Titled “Life Is Eazi – Vol 2; Lagos To London”

    Celebrity News By David F.Nov 4, 2018No Comments2 Mins Read
    Facebook Twitter WhatsApp Pinterest LinkedIn Tumblr Email Reddit VKontakte

    MR EAZIBIGMr Eazi is set to release his sophomore project, ”Life Is Eazi – Vol 2; Lagos To London” on November 9th.

    Ahead of the much anticipated release of the body of work, the singer has now shared the official tracklist of the mixtape alongside the names of all the featured artists.

    ”Lagos To London” consists of 15 tracks and features a number of guest appearances including established names like 2Baba, Burna Boy, Simi and Maleek Berry, international acts like Diplo, Giggs and Sneakbo as well as fast rising talents in Lady Donli and more.

    In a separate tweet, Eazi appreciated everyone who worked with him on the project, stating,

    ”So many great & selfless people came together to help me make this sonic compilation It is with so much gratitude that i share this tracklist!!!”

    The singer has enjoyed a steady rise both locally and globally since the release of his debut mixtape, ”Accra To Lagos” in 2017.

    Within that period, he has gone on several tours across Europe, and featured prominently on the international charts.

    He had previously released a number of singles like ‘Property’, ‘London Town’ and ‘Keys To The City’ in the build up leading to the mixtape release.
